Exploring the World of ThinkPad Laptop Cases
The market offers a wide array of laptop cases, each with its own set of advantages and disadvantages. Understanding the different types available will help you narrow down your options and choose the best one for your needs.
Sleeves are the epitome of minimalist protection. These slim, form-fitting enclosures provide a snug fit for your ThinkPad, protecting it from scratches and minor bumps. Sleeves are lightweight, compact, and easy to slip into a larger bag or carry on their own. However, they offer limited protection against drops and typically lack storage for accessories. Sleeves are available in a variety of materials, including neoprene (a flexible, water-resistant synthetic rubber), felt (a soft, eco-friendly fabric), and leather (a durable and stylish option). Finding the right Laptop Case for ThinkPad means understanding that sleeves offer less protection but greater portability.
Hard shell cases provide a more rigid form of protection. These cases typically snap directly onto your ThinkPad, providing a close-fitting shield against scratches, dents, and other types of surface damage. Hard shell cases are particularly effective at protecting against accidental bumps and scrapes. However, they can add bulk to your laptop and may trap heat, potentially leading to overheating. They also may be prone to cracking or breaking if subjected to excessive force. Hard shell cases are usually made from polycarbonate or ABS plastic.
Laptop bags, including briefcases, messenger bags, and backpacks, offer the most comprehensive protection and storage. These bags typically feature padded compartments specifically designed to hold laptops, as well as additional pockets and compartments for accessories, documents, and other essentials. Laptop bags are comfortable to carry and come in a variety of styles to suit different needs and preferences. However, they can be bulkier and more expensive than sleeves or hard shell cases. When searching for a Laptop Case for ThinkPad, a bag provides the best overall protection and utility.
Laptop skins, also known as vinyl wraps, are thin adhesive coverings that adhere directly to your laptop’s surface. Skins primarily protect against scratches and offer a way to personalize your ThinkPad with custom designs. They add minimal bulk and are relatively inexpensive. However, they provide very limited impact protection and can be difficult to install without creating air bubbles or wrinkles.
Deciphering the Case Selection Process
Choosing the right laptop case requires careful consideration of several factors. It’s not just about picking the prettiest or cheapest option; it’s about finding a case that meets your specific needs and provides the level of protection you require.
Size and compatibility are paramount. The case you choose must be the correct size for your specific ThinkPad model. ThinkPads come in a variety of sizes and configurations, so it’s crucial to check the dimensions of your laptop and compare them to the case’s specifications. Don’t assume that a case designed for a different laptop model will fit your ThinkPad, even if they have similar screen sizes. Refer to compatibility charts provided by the case manufacturer to ensure a perfect fit. Using the wrong size can result in inadequate protection or even damage to your laptop.
Material and durability are also critical considerations. The material of the case will determine its level of protection, its weight, and its overall aesthetic. Nylon and polyester are durable and water-resistant materials commonly used in laptop bags. Leather offers a stylish and professional look but requires more maintenance. Polycarbonate is a strong and lightweight plastic used in hard shell cases. Look for cases with reinforced stitching and high-quality zippers, as these components are often the first to fail.
Assess your protection needs. Are you primarily using your ThinkPad in an office environment, or are you frequently traveling or working in more challenging environments? If you’re often on the go, you’ll need a case that offers greater impact protection and water resistance. Look for features like shock-absorbing padding, reinforced corners, and waterproof materials. If you’re primarily using your ThinkPad in a controlled environment, a simpler and less bulky case may suffice.

Selecting Some Cases Specifically for ThinkPads
(Note: Specific model recommendations change rapidly, so I can only provide general advice and the types of things to look for.)
For sleeves, search for options that explicitly state compatibility with your ThinkPad model (e.g., “Sleeve for ThinkPad X1 Carbon Gen 10”). Look for memory foam padding and a plush interior lining.
When it comes to hard shell cases, ensure they snap on securely without obstructing ports or ventilation. Read reviews carefully to check for reports of cracking or overheating.
For laptop bags, prioritize padded compartments and durable materials. Consider brands known for their quality and craftsmanship, such as Timbuk2 or Thule. Look for features like water-resistant fabrics and reinforced stitching.
When searching for Laptop Case for ThinkPad skins, choose reputable brands like dbrand or Skinit that offer precise cuts and high-quality adhesive.
Caring for Your Investment: Maintaining Your Laptop Case
Even the most durable laptop case requires proper care and maintenance to ensure its longevity. Clean your case regularly according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Use a damp cloth to wipe away dirt and grime. For leather cases, use a leather cleaner and conditioner to prevent cracking and drying. When not in use, store your case in a dry and well-ventilated area. Avoid exposing it to extreme temperatures or direct sunlight. Regularly inspect your case for wear and tear, such as ripped seams or broken zippers. Address any issues promptly to prevent them from worsening.
